Output a26cb0dab3daa921e8202e153e190fb93eaaa1324dbf7daace736e14de9409e1:4

value
161019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59467c3c3c9bf9f156cb3112e84e1f19a4d3183c OP_EQUAL
address
39q4W2A5FvSrcU7u65dhK7y6S2HwPzh4rj
transaction
a26cb0dab3daa921e8202e153e190fb93eaaa1324dbf7daace736e14de9409e1
confirmations
134995
spent
true